With reference to the Ludgershall to andover line (ex MSW Cheltenham to Southampton) rumour has it that together with shrinkage of army camps big movements are in hand for the repatriation of troops and vehicles from Afghanistan.
I believe that together with Ashchurch Ludgershall is closing and all the vehicles are going to Lyneham. The real estate is to be used for married quarters for the new super garrison at Tidworth. This means that the line will no longer be needed and indeed will get in the way of any development. So on the one hand the line will become obsolete and on the other the population will expand by 2-3000 so the line could become even more useful as a commuter line into Andover. This means of course that the bus company will not want competition. Food for thought!
